Chapter 456: Hello, Lil’ Sis
She completely forgot that Arthur shouldn’t even know Nnenna talk more of behaving that way around her.
In this moment, surrounded by all this tension and suspicion, she looked like the only person in the room truly at peace.
After eating a few more pieces of popcorn, Arthur finally turned his gaze back to Jana as if she were an afterthought. "What were you saying again?" he asked lazily, genuinely looking like he’d forgotten every word she had spoken.
The crowd nearly fainted.
This was supposed to be his terrible revenge for having his feelings rejected? If anything, it was more like he simply couldn’t be bothered to care.
A ripple of whispers spread through the room.
"I don’t believe Jana anymore," a girl muttered to her friend, her voice low but fierce. "If Prince Arthur really liked her, would he act like she’s invisible?"
"Exactly," her friend whispered back. "And look at her, she’s not even his type. He could have any princess or duchess he wanted."
One of the lecturers shook his head, adjusting his glasses. "This is ridiculous. If she truly rejected the prince, he wouldn’t be sitting there eating popcorn like nothing happened."
"Yeah," another lecturer agreed quietly. "You would think he would at least look angry or embarrassed. He just looks...bored."
"I told you," a boy hissed to the girl next to him. "Jana made this up. He doesn’t even remember what she said!"
"I knew something was off the moment she started crying," someone else added, crossing their arms. "It felt forced. Like she was acting."
All around the room, suspicion bloomed like weeds breaking through stone, and more and more people began to realize that Jana’s carefully crafted story was starting to crumble.
Jana, at this point, wanted the ground to crack open and swallow her whole. This level of embarrassment crashed over her like a tidal wave, smashing through even her thick skin. She clenched her hands at her sides, her lips trembling. She couldn’t take this anymore.
Just when she was about to throw in the towel for today and storm out, rapid footsteps were heard.
"Hey, guys!" a bright, familiar voice rang out.
Everyone turned in unison.
"You won’t believe what some silly boy just told me," the newcomer continued, sounding equal parts annoyed and amused. "I had just parked my car when he sprinted up, yelling that my girlfriend was in trouble and that I had to come save her."
It was Carl.
He strolled in casually, dressed in his crisp academy lecturer’s uniform, hair still windswept from driving.
"He didn’t even wait for me to ask him where this so called girlfriend of mine came from," Carl went on, scratching his head, "before he took off again. Can you believe it?"
Jana felt her vision tilt.
Carl’s eyes finally swept across the room. Initially he was talking to Arthur whom he saw first but then he noticed Nnenna lounging in a chair, Ava perched neatly beside Arthur, and Nnenna and an unfamiliar girl calmly munching popcorn like this was a late night movie.
Carl blinked.
Then, completely oblivious to the stunned silence of the crowd, and Jana’s face going sheet white he walked over to Nnenna.
As Carl walked over, he kept right on talking, his deep voice ringing across the silent hall.
"What girl could that boy possibly be talking about? Me? Prince Carl?" He let out a soft, incredulous laugh. "I haven’t dated anyone since I understood what love really means. And let me be clear, I would never waste a girl’s time with this thing people call dating."
His gaze swept the crowd, daring anyone to challenge him.
Then he turned back to Arthur.
"If I like a girl, I’ll be her friend first. Then I’ll court her properly. If she feels the same, I’ll marry her. Why would I confuse her, acting like I’m unsure of my own feelings? I already know what I want, a future worth building."
The crowd stirred uneasily. Several people darted glances at Jana, who looked like she might faint.
Carl stopped beside Nnenna’s seat. Without so much as a pause, he picked up her bag, set it on his laps, and calmly sat down in the empty chair, completely blocking Emily, who froze mid popcorn bite.
Then he turned to Nnenna with a bright, teasing smile, as if he hadn’t just shattered Jana’s entire story in two sentences.
"Hello, lil’ sis," he said in a soft, familiar tone that made the crowd’s jaws drop.
He reached out a hand, ignoring the angry glare she leveled at him.
"Pass the popcorn."
Nnenna smacked his hand away, but Carl didn’t care. He just leaned forward, grabbed a handful anyway, and popped the kernels into his mouth, chewing with deep satisfaction as if none of this chaos had anything to do with him.
Little sis?!
The crowd had seen enough. From the way Arthur, Carl, Ava, Nnenna, and Emily interacted, calm, unbothered, even sharing snacks, there was no longer any doubt about who was telling the truth.
Whispers spread like wildfire
"Since when did they all know each other? Is it an act?" A girl whispered in disbelief.
"Are you blind?" The person beside her reacted. "Can’t you see that Prince Arthur, Prince Carl and even Princess Ava have acknowledged Nnenna since ages ago. This obviously didn’t start today. We’ve all been so stupid!"
"So they’re really all close friends..."
"Jana’s story is falling apart."
"How embarrassing."
Jana felt her whole face burn. It felt like her shame was boiling her from the inside out. But even with so many eyes on her, she refused to give up. She clenched her fists and took a shaky step closer to Carl, her voice rising as her desperation grew.
"Carl..." she called out, trying to sound gentle but only managing to sound hysterical. "How could you be so friendly to this girl? Don’t be deceived by her innocent act. She’s not a good person at all!"
